Weather in January

January, the same as December, is a wintry winter month in Saš, Serbia, with an average temperature ranging between max 1.2°C (34.2°F) and min -5.2°C (22.6°F).

Temperature

January brings the lowest temperatures, with an average high of 1.2°C (34.2°F) and an average low of -5.2°C (22.6°F).

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ity are January and February, with an average relative humidity of 88%.

Rainfall

In Saš, in January, during 10.3 rainfall days, 43mm (1.69")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 171.5 rainfall days, and 651mm (25.63")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through April, October through December. The month with the most snowfall is January, when snow falls for 11.6 days and typically aggregates up to 214mm (8.43") of snow.

Daylight

In Saš, the average length of the day in January is 9h and 26min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 07:10 and sunset at 16:14.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 06:55 and sunset at 16:49 CET.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January is 4.4h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index in Saš are January, February,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a low thre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
